Unicameral passes final redistricting maps

Photo: WOWT 6 News

(Lincoln, NE) -- Nebraska state legislators come to an agreement on the state's new redistricting maps.

Thursday morning, the Unicameral approved the six new maps. The maps, which were redrawn based on 2020 U.S. Census data, then went to Governor Pete Ricketts for final approval, which he gave. Some of the biggest changes come to the state's largest metropolitan areas. In Lincoln, some of the surrounding rural districts will now stretch into the city. In the Omaha area, the new Congressional map keeps all of Douglas County in the 2nd District, along with western Sarpy County. The new map also adds Saunders County to District 2.
